
The Growth of the Consultancy Model and the Future of SME Law Firms

The increase in consultant firms we are seeing is reshaping mid-market and high street operations, with existing business models at risk of being disrupted. As a result, SME law firms are under increased pressure to adopt and align with this strategy – investing in IT infrastructure and reducing back-office costs.
But when most firms are facing historic lows in available cash, with partners generally reluctant to commit additional capital, what are the options to survive and thrive in a shifting market?
Watch this webinar for a debate on whether the consultancy model is threatening the future of traditional operations and if SME law firms can remain competitive by optimising and prioritising the following tech initiatives:
- Technology transformation as a strategic imperative
- Evolving ways of addressing critical technology needs
- The changing nature of work and its implications for talent and culture
- Governance requirements for shifting risks and opportunities
